They sure made it hot for us this year but the Cardinals
came through in great style clear to the end when we
needed every ounce of enemy to win. We needed it ant
we had it. There's the story in a nutshell. It seems as
though the team line up just as well on their smoking
hahits as they do on the hall field. Here's our line-up on
smoking: 21 out of 23 of the Cardinals prefer Camels.
